Kinds Of Industrial Scales
Numerous kinds of industrial ranges deal with the varied requirements of various sectors, each made to take care of details evaluating tasks with accuracy and dependability. Amongst one of the most usual kinds are flooring scales, which are excellent for evaluating heavy and large products. These ranges typically include big platforms and can accommodate palletized goods, making them vital in storage facilities and delivery facilities.
An additional type is bench scales, which are usually utilized for smaller sized things in manufacturing and retail setups. They give accurate dimensions for items that require precision, such as chemicals or components in production line (Industrial Scales). For mobile procedures, portable scales use adaptability and ease of transport, ideal for fieldwork or temporary setups
In addition, specialized ranges like checkweighers are used in manufacturing lines to keep top quality control by guaranteeing that products satisfy weight specs. Each kind of commercial range plays a critical duty in boosting functional effectiveness and accuracy across various sectors.
Just How Evaluating Devices Work
Weighing devices are crucial components that make it possible for accurate measurement of mass throughout different commercial scales. These systems make use of numerous concepts of physics and engineering to give accurate weight readings, vital for supply management, top quality control, and conformity with regulatory standards.
One common kind of weighing mechanism is the lots cell, which operates the concept of stress gauges. When a tons is applied, the lots cell warps somewhat, creating an electric signal proportional to the weight. This signal is then exchanged an understandable weight dimension by the range's electronic devices.
One more extensively made use of device is the mechanical balance, which uses a system of bars and weights. Industrial Scales. This approach counts on the concept of balance, where the weight of the item being determined is balanced versus known weights, permitting direct measurement
Furthermore, hydraulic and pneumatically-driven scales utilize liquid characteristics concepts to gauge weight. These systems Find Out More use the stress put in by a load to identify weight, providing high precision for massive tons.
Proper Use Strategies
When utilizing commercial ranges, sticking to proper usage techniques is essential for maintaining and guaranteeing precise dimensions equipment integrity. Firstly, it is necessary to choose the appropriate range for your details application, as ranges vary in capacity and accuracy.
Before weighing, guarantee that the range is positioned on a stable, level surface area without disruptions or resonances. This will aid to reduce errors caused by external variables. In addition, calibrate the range according to the supplier's specs prior to utilize, guaranteeing that it is operating appropriately.
When positioning things on the scale, distribute the weight equally to stay clear of tipping or damaging the equipment. Constantly allow the scale to maintain before videotaping the weight, as fluctuations may take place during initial placement. For bulk products, make use of containers that are proper for the scale dimension to protect against overloading.
In addition, prevent placing extremely warm or cool things directly on the scale, as temperature variants can affect accuracy. Keep the weighing platform totally free and clean of debris to avoid contamination and guarantee dependable outcomes. By complying with these methods, individuals can make the most of the efficiency and durability of their industrial ranges.
Maintenance and Calibration Tips
Ensuring the durability and accuracy of industrial ranges calls for attentive maintenance and regular calibration. A preventive upkeep schedule is essential; it needs to include regular evaluations to determine wear and tear, especially on tons cells and various other sensitive parts. Regularly cleansing the scale's surface area and ensuring the bordering location is without debris will help preserve its stability and efficiency.
Calibration is equally vital and must be executed at normal intervals or whenever the scale experiences substantial changes in temperature, humidity, or physical displacement. Use qualified calibration weights that are traceable to national standards for accuracy. File each calibration session thoroughly to track efficiency over time and identify any trends or repeating problems.
Train all operators on proper range use and maintenance protocols to make certain regular efficiency and accuracy. By sticking to these upkeep and calibration tips, individuals can improve the dependability of their industrial ranges, guaranteeing optimal procedure in any type of setting.
